De volgorde "10110000" vertegenwoordigt een binair getal. Het is niet inherent gebonden aan een specifieke programmeertaal. Dit is waarom:
* binair is universeel: Binair (met behulp van 0S en 1s) is de fundamentele taal van computers. Alle programmeertalen vormen uiteindelijk tot binaire instructies die de CPU begrijpt.
* interpretatie: De betekenis van "10110000" hangt af van hoe het wordt geïnterpreteerd:
* als een nummer: In binair vertegenwoordigt "10110000" het decimale nummer 176.
* als karakter: Afhankelijk van de tekencodering (zoals ASCII of Unicode) kan het een specifiek karakter vertegenwoordigen.
* als geheugenadres: In sommige contexten kan het worden gebruikt om te verwijzen naar een specifieke locatie in computergeheugen.
Hoe programmeertalen binair gebruiken:
* gegevensrepresentatie: Talen gebruiken binair om getallen, tekens en andere gegevenstypen weer te geven.
* Machine -instructies: Wanneer een programma wordt samengesteld of geïnterpreteerd, wordt de code omgezet in binaire instructies die de CPU kan uitvoeren.
Voorbeeld:
Laten we zeggen dat u de volgende code in Python hebt:
`` `Python
Nummer =176
Afdrukken (nummer)
`` `
Achter de schermen zal Python "176" vertegenwoordigen als de binaire volgorde "10110000" en de nodige machine -instructies uitvoeren om het nummer op uw scherm weer te geven.
Samenvattend is "10110000" een binaire weergave. Elke programmeertaal kan werken met binaire gegevens, maar het is de onderliggende machine die deze direct begrijpt en verwerkt. |